Outline of Final Research Achievements |
Crystal structure control of organic conductors utilizing supramolecular architecture is highly useful to develop organic electronic devices. The surface of the single crystal has higher completeness than those of thin layer films and it would be more preferable to develop hetero junctions for electronic devices. From this point of view, we have prepared prototypes of hetero junctions between single crystals of organic conductors and investigated their fundamental electronic properties. We have also synthesized a new series of organic donor molecules containing a fluoromethyl group and prepared their cation radical salts as the substrate for hetero junctions of organic conductors. In addition, we have found novel reduction reactions of organic cation radical salts by applying electric field to their single crystals and it would be highly useful to develop single crystal organic electronic devices.
